Overview of Cisco’s Security Ecosystem
Cisco’s security portfolio integrates seamlessly with its broader networking infrastructure, providing layered protection that spans endpoints, networks, and cloud environments. Key components include advanced endpoint protection platforms, secure access service edge (SASE) solutions, and managed detection and response (MDR) services. Users highlight the platform’s ability to consolidate multiple security functions into a unified console, reducing operational complexity.
At its core, Cisco Security Services leverage AI-driven threat intelligence from the Talos research team, one of the world’s largest threat research organizations. This feeds real-time updates into tools like Secure Endpoint and Secure Firewall, enabling proactive defense against malware, ransomware, and zero-day exploits. Organizations in sectors like finance, healthcare, and government praise the scalability, noting how it supports everything from small teams to global enterprises.
Core Features and Capabilities
The strength of Cisco Security Services lies in its multifaceted feature set. Here’s a breakdown of standout elements based on user experiences:
- Endpoint Detection and Response (EDR): Real-time monitoring with behavioral analysis detects anomalies before they escalate. Users report high efficacy against fileless attacks.
- Network Visibility and Segmentation: Tools like Secure Network Analytics provide deep packet inspection, identifying lateral movement in breaches.
- Cloud Security Posture Management: Integration with AWS, Azure, and Google Cloud ensures consistent policies across hybrid environments.
- Automated Response: One-click isolation of compromised devices minimizes dwell time, a feature lauded in high-stakes environments.
- Threat Hunting Capabilities: Advanced queries and sandboxing allow security teams to proactively hunt for hidden threats.
These features combine to form a zero-trust architecture, where every access request is verified regardless of origin. A table summarizing tiered offerings illustrates the progression:
| Tier | Key Features | Ideal For |
|---|---|---|
| Essentials | Basic EDR, file reputation, vulnerability scanning | Small to mid-size businesses |
| Advantage | Advanced search, malware analytics | Mid-size enterprises needing threat hunting |
| Premier | MDR by Cisco experts, continuous hunting | Large organizations with complex threats |

Challenges and Areas for Improvement
No solution is perfect, and Cisco Security Services face criticism in a few areas. Deployment complexity tops the list, especially for organizations new to Cisco ecosystems. Initial setup can take weeks, involving agent rollouts and policy configurations. Users recommend starting with a proof-of-concept (PoC) to mitigate this.
Reporting and analytics draw mixed feedback. While dashboards are intuitive, custom report generation lacks depth, forcing reliance on third-party tools like Splunk. Pricing transparency is another pain point; bundled services can lead to unexpected costs during scaling. Smaller firms find the entry barrier high, preferring lighter alternatives like CrowdStrike or Microsoft Defender.
- Resource Intensity: Agents consume notable CPU on older hardware.
- Alert Fatigue: High-fidelity detection sometimes overwhelms SOC teams.
- Support Variability: Premier tiers get elite assistance, but standard support lags.
Deployment and ROI Analysis
Implementation success hinges on preparation. Best practices include:
- Assess current infrastructure for compatibility.
- Engage Cisco partners for guided onboarding.
- Pilot in segmented networks to validate performance.
- Train staff on the SecureX console for unified orchestration.
ROI calculators from Cisco project 3x returns via threat prevention, backed by user data showing 50-70% drops in malware incidents post-deployment. Compared to competitors, Cisco excels in network-integrated security but trails in pure endpoint speed against next-gen players.
Competitive Landscape
Cisco Security Services compete with Palo Alto Networks, Fortinet, and Check Point. Strengths include ecosystem lock-in for Cisco shops and superior network-layer defense. Weaknesses? Endpoint agents are bulkier than rivals, and cloud-native focus lags hyperscalers.

Who Should Choose Cisco Security Services?
Ideal for enterprises with Cisco-heavy networks seeking integrated security. It’s less suited for startups or Microsoft-centric shops. Sectors like manufacturing and public sector benefit most from its rugged compliance features (e.g., FedRAMP authorization).
